Address

13nbsgKkt1VbSoj8YaAxqfdTrNbSk9BdU3Copy

Total Received

18.1502299 BTC

Total Sent

18.14664488 BTC

№ Transactions

250

Final Balance

0.00358502 BTC

Transactions
Filter